From Osaka's Nanko port industrial zone to the Sakai chemical complex, titanium welded tubes are integral to the region's most critical infrastructure and manufacturing processes.
The Sakai-Senboku Industrial Complex and Osaka Bay petrochemical clusters rely on titanium welded tubes for heat exchangers and reactor cooling systems handling sulfuric acid, chlorine, and other aggressive media. Grade 2 and Grade 7 titanium tubes provide unmatched corrosion resistance and extended service life.
Coastal facilities in the Osaka Bay Area and Kansai region deploy titanium welded tubes in multi-effect distillation (MED) and reverse osmosis (RO) pre-treatment systems. Titanium's exceptional resistance to seawater corrosion and biofouling makes it the definitive choice for condenser and heat exchanger tubing in these environments.
Osaka and the broader Kansai corridor host major semiconductor wafer fabs and flat-panel display manufacturers. Ultra-high-purity titanium welded tubes are used in chemical vapor deposition (CVD) gas delivery lines and wet process chemical distribution systems where contamination-free fluid transfer is mandatory.
Thermal and combined-cycle power stations along Osaka's industrial waterfront utilize titanium welded tubes in steam condensers and cooling water systems. The material's ability to withstand chlorinated seawater cooling loops significantly reduces maintenance downtime and lifecycle costs compared to stainless steel alternatives.
Osaka's status as one of Japan's busiest port cities drives demand for titanium components in offshore structures, ship heat exchangers, and desalination units aboard vessels. Titanium's density-to-strength ratio and saltwater corrosion immunity make welded tubes ideal for marine engineering applications throughout the Osaka Bay.
Osaka's thriving pharmaceutical sector — anchored by global companies in the Umeda and Nakanoshima business districts — requires biocompatible, sterile-grade titanium tubing for bioreactors, sterilization systems, and high-purity fluid handling. Titanium's non-reactive surface and ease of passivation are critical advantages in GMP-regulated environments.

Japan's commitment to achieving carbon neutrality by 2050 is accelerating investment in hydrogen production, green ammonia synthesis, and offshore wind energy — all sectors that demand corrosion-resistant titanium tube systems. Osaka's Yumeshima smart city development and associated clean energy projects are expected to generate significant new titanium tube procurement volumes through 2030.
Osaka's manufacturing sector is undergoing a technology upgrade cycle, with companies investing in Industry 4.0 automation and precision engineering. This shift is increasing demand for tighter-tolerance titanium welded tubes with enhanced surface finish specifications, driving procurement toward suppliers with advanced quality management systems and full material traceability.
In the wake of increasing typhoon intensity and sea-level concerns, Osaka's municipal and prefectural governments are investing in coastal flood barriers, upgraded seawater intake systems, and resilient port infrastructure. These large-scale civil engineering projects are creating sustained demand for marine-grade titanium welded tubes that can perform reliably for decades in saltwater environments.

Japan's national strategy to rebuild domestic semiconductor capacity is driving significant fab construction and expansion across the Kansai region. New cleanroom facilities and chemical distribution infrastructure require ultra-high-purity titanium welded tubing, creating a growing niche market for specialized grades and surface finishes that meet SEMI standards.
As Osaka's aerospace component manufacturing and mobility innovation ecosystem expands — particularly around the Itami and Kansai International Airport corridors — the demand for lightweight titanium tubes in structural and fluid-system applications is growing. Titanium's superior strength-to-weight ratio versus steel and aluminum positions welded tubes as a key material in next-generation mobility platforms.
